How to Reach Erftstadt, Germany

Erftstadt is a charming town located in the state of North Rhine-Westphalia, Germany. With its rich history, picturesque landscapes, and vibrant culture, Erftstadt is a must-visit destination for travelers. Here are a few ways to reach this beautiful town:

By Air:

If you are traveling from abroad, the nearest international airport is Cologne Bonn Airport (CGN). From the airport, you can take a taxi or use public transportation to reach Erftstadt. The journey takes approximately 30 minutes by car or around an hour by train.

By Train:

Erftstadt is well-connected by train services. The town has its own train station, Erftstadt Station, which is served by regional trains. If you are traveling from major cities in Germany, such as Cologne or Bonn, you can easily reach Erftstadt by train. The train journey offers scenic views of the surrounding countryside.

By Car:

Erftstadt is conveniently located near major highways, making it easily accessible by car. If you are driving from Cologne, take the A1 highway towards Trier and then exit at Erftstadt. From Bonn, take the A555 highway towards Cologne and then follow the signs to Erftstadt. The town has ample parking facilities, so you can explore the area at your own pace.

By Bus:

Another option to reach Erftstadt is by bus. The town is well-connected to neighboring cities and towns through an extensive bus network. You can check the local bus schedules and routes to plan your journey accordingly. Buses offer a convenient and affordable way to travel within the region.

By Bicycle:

If you are an adventure enthusiast or prefer eco-friendly transportation, Erftstadt is easily accessible by bicycle. The town is surrounded by scenic cycling routes, allowing you to enjoy the beautiful countryside while pedaling your way to Erftstadt. There are also bike rental services available in the area.

Getting to know Erftstadt

Erftstadt is a beautiful town located in the Rhineland region of Germany. The town derives its name from the river Erft which flows through the town. Erftstadt boasts a rich history and has many historic sites that are popular tourist attractions.

One of the most important landmarks in Erftstadt is the castle of Lechenich. The castle was built in the 12th century and is a great example of Gothic architecture. Another popular historic site in Erftstadt is the St. Kilian Church which was built in the early 18th century and is known for its impressive Baroque interior.

Aside from its rich history, Erftstadt is also known for its beautiful natural attractions. The town is home to several parks and forests where visitors can enjoy hiking, cycling, and picnicking. One of the most popular parks in Erftstadt is the Kierberg Forest which is home to several species of birds and animals.

In addition, Erftstadt has a vibrant community and hosts several cultural events throughout the year. The town is also home to many restaurants and pubs where visitors can experience traditional German cuisine and nightlife.
